Monascus is one of the most essential microbial resources in China,with thousands of years of history.Modern science has proved that Monascus can produce pigment,ergosterol,monacolin K,-aminobutyric acid,and other functionally active substances.Currently,Monascus is used to produce a variety of foods,health products,and pharmaceuticals,and its pigments are widely used as food additives.However,Monascus also makes a harmful polyketide component called citrinin in the fermentation process;citrinin has toxic effects on the kidneys such as teratogenicity,carcinogenicity,and mutagenicity(Gong et al.,2019).The presence of citrinin renders Monascus and its products potentially hazardous,which has led many countries to set limits and standards on citrinin content. 展开更多
